Police commenced recording statements from Tamil politicians, civil society activists and public for taking part in the recent protest march from Pottuvil and Polikandy which was staged alleging minorities are being oppressed by the government.
A group of police officials from various police stations in North and East recorded a statement from Batticaloa TNA Parliamentarian R. Shanakiyan today at his office.
Mr Shanakiyan was grilled over five hours in his office by police officials.
He was questioned on the basis whether he violated the Court order issued by respective Magistrate Courts and failed to adhere COVID-19 regulations during the protest which saw thousands of people take part across the regions.
Mayor of Jaffna Municipal Council V. Manivannan was also questioned by the police over his role in organizing the protest and a statement was recorded in his office today.
Meanwhile, a 26 year old youth was taken into custody by Point Pedro police for taking part in the protest and later released after a statement was recorded over six hours at the police station. He was tracked by the police through the number plate of this motorbike.
